Do you have a passion for coordinating people and operations to deliver safe, efficient outcomes? If so, we're looking for an Operations Superintendent to join our team in Darwin, NT, on a permanent full-time basis.
Why You'll Want to Join Us
This is a hands-on operations role where your ability to coordinate people, manage day-to-day schedules, and respond to operational challenges will make a real difference. You'll gain exposure to a diverse range of operations, from harbour towage and terminal towage to supporting navy activities, giving you a unique breadth of experience that few ports can offer. Working closely with the Port Manager, you'll ensure vessels and crews are resourced, compliant, and supported, while fostering a safe and positive workplace culture.
How You'll Make a Difference
Reporting to the local Port Manager, your key responsibilities will include:
Being the first point of contact for crews on operational and people-related matters
Coordinating training, certification, and compliance to ensure operational readiness
Supporting technical maintenance and dry-docking planning alongside the Technical Superintendent
Engaging with port authorities, committees, and stakeholders on behalf of Svitzer
Driving health, safety, environment, and quality standards across port operations
Providing reports and compliance documentation to customers and stakeholders
Assisting with budgeting, cost control, and supporting commercial opportunities
